HTTPS Guard: Bypass SNI for Secure Browsing

HTTPS Guard: Bypass SNI is a free utility application designed for iPhone users, enabling seamless access to the Internet while maintaining privacy and security. The app allows users to bypass site censorship and access blocked content without experiencing slowdowns. It offers features such as encrypted data transmission via HTTPS connections, ensuring that users' personal information remains protected while browsing.

In addition to providing censorship circumvention, HTTPS Guard also includes an ad-blocking function that targets various types of intrusive advertisements. Users can customize their DNS settings and enjoy strong SNI protection for both HTTP and HTTPS traffic. With its local VPN capabilities, HTTPS Guard ensures a fast and secure online experience, making it a valuable tool for those seeking to enhance their Internet freedom and security.
